Jatun Q'asa (Quechua jatun, hatun big, great, q'asa mountain pass,[2] "great mountain pass", also spelled Jatun Khasa) is a 3,568-metre-high (11,706 ft) mountain in the Bolivian Andes. It is located in the Chuquisaca Department, Oropeza Province, on the border of the municipalities of Sucre and Yotala.[1][3]
